Introduction:

The Great Desert Tracks Mapping Expedition began after Hema Maps identified an area in Australia that had not been mapped since the 1970s and certainly never with GPS technology and detailed, on-the-ground field checking. The area was so vast it had to be mapped in two phases. The first phase included every trafficable road and track from the Great Australian Bight in the south to the Kimberley in the north and from near the Stuart Highway in the east to the Pilbara in the west, which amounted to about 48,000km of tracks and roads travelled. The first phase culminated in the release of four maps in 1999. The second phase was field checked in 2000 and continued along the same northern and southern boundaries as the earlier map sheets and reached across to Quilpie in south-west Queensland and White Cliffs in Outback New South Wales. The field checkers clocked up 45,000km while surveying the 25,000km of additional roads and tracks for the two new sheets, as well as several thousand further kilometres in the area covered by the original four map sheets. The results of these expeditions are now two new and four revised maps.

Map Projection:
All of the Great Desert Tracks Maps are Lambert Conformal Conic Projections using the WGS84 datum. Contact Hema Maps for more information such as the standard parallels used.

Road Classifications:
The road and track classifications are based on a general assumption that map users are familiar with the often-rough condition of outback roads and tracks. Any unsealed road or track can be hazardous due to washouts, sand, mud or bull-dust patches and extreme corrugations. Use classifications as a general guide and always seek local advice.

GPS Plotted Roads and Tracks:
The PURPLE roads and tracks were accurately plotted with a GPS and laptop computer during the Great Desert Tracks Mapping Expeditions. Distances were also checked and have been rounded to the nearest kilometre (variations may occur due to wheel-slip and/or tyre pressure).

The RED road and track information has been compiled from AUSLIG 1:250,000 Geodata and other sources. The exact location and/or condition of these roads and tracks were not verified during the Expeditions so this information must therefore be treated with caution. (All highway information has been verified.)

The "Great Desert Tracks" maps are displayed using the OziExplorer Lite map viewer. OziExplorer Lite is designed for map viewing but has other features available including Index Map Selection, Name Search, Area Calculation, the ability to add Map Features and Map Comments to a map, and Distance and Bearing Measurement. You can explore these features from the menu options or by using the button toolbar located under the menu for quick access to each feature.
Also available is the very popular OziExplorer GPS Mapping Software which will work with Garmin, Lowrance, Magellan, Eagle and MLR GPS receivers for the upload and download of waypoints, routes and tracks. With OziExplorer running on your computer and connected to a GPS, it can also be used for real time navigation (moving map) to show your position as you move.
